#f11941 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f11941 is composed of 94.5% red, 9.8%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.6% magenta, 73%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#f11941 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3282 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f11941 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f11941 has RGB values of R:241, G:25,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.73,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15800641.

Shades and Tints of #f11941
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0102 is the darkest color, while #fff7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f11941
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8082 is the less saturated color, while #fa103b is the most saturated one.
